No chimney or flue Ethanol stoves are able to be used without a chimney. require a burner tray filled with bioethanol and a lighter to ignite the flame. Bioethanol produces three primary by-products of burning water vapour and heat and a tiny amount carbon dioxide. They are therefore eco-friendly since they do not emit harmful fumes or smoke. They are also portable and can be moved to any area of the room. This makes them ideal for rooms without chimneys or in areas where traditional fireplaces would be difficult to install. Another benefit of a self-standing bioethanol stove is that it can be put in without the need for a building permit. This is because it isn't required to make any structural changes that are major, and because the fuel is not toxic and non-toxic, it won't impact the air quality. Like any open flame product, it is essential to keep any flammable material away from the fire while it is burning.
